2024 Petaluma Gap Pinot Noir
Tasting notes: This wine starts off with a pop! Ripe cherry, mushroom and violets show first on the nose but it is deep and complex bringing forward aromas of earthy loam and a bit of fresh cut wood. As you sit with the wine for a bit, there is a nice Rhubarb aromatic that makes your mouth water. Take a sip you get a big bright splash of red fruit. That bright raspberry on the front of palate is balanced by fine tannins that stretch out the finish and lend an earthy note. We’d suggest pairing it with something that blends rich flavors with savory notes (right now as we taste it, we are dreaming of a BLT). (2.18.26 - Alan)
Clones: 2A, 667
Cases produced: 71 cases
